The Best Resort in Panchgani for a Relaxing Getaway

Escape to Basilica Resort in Panchgani for a serene and peaceful retreat. Whether you’re looking to unwind or reconnect with nature, our resort offers the perfect environment for a relaxing getaway. Discover more about the best resort in Panchgani for ultimate relaxation!